Online & Distance Learning at Indiana University-Bloomington
Many students take online classes at Indiana University-Bloomington. Of 48,424 students, 3,249 (7%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 17,945 (37%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Communication & Journalism Graduates from Indiana University-Bloomington
Students who complete Indiana University-Bloomington’s Communication & Journalism program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$40,747 |
| 2 years | $46,858 |
| 3 years | $52,312 |
| 4 years | $58,564 |
| 5 years | $60,835 |
Is this above or below average for the school? At the four-year mark, Communication & Journalism graduates from Indiana University-Bloomington report median earnings of $58,564, compared with $74,553 for all Indiana University-Bloomington graduates — about 21% lower than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Typical debt at graduation for Communication & Journalism graduates from Indiana University-Bloomington stands at $20,500.
